NATO Chief Critiques Russian Submarine’s Unexpected Retreat
The recent incident involving a Russian submarine, which had to make a hasty retreat due to a malfunction, has become a point of international amusement and concern. NATO’s chief, Mark Rutte, could not resist a public jest regarding the submarine’s predicament. The occurrence did not just spark laughter but also reignited discussions about the underlying tensions between NATO and Russia.
Russian Submarine Malfunction Raises Eyebrows
The event unfolded instead like a scene from a spy novel, when the Russian submarine, primed for secrecy and strength, found itself floundering unexpectedly. Mid-mission, it encountered a technical hiccup that forced an ignominious retreat, or as NATO described—’limping home.’ This setback for Russia’s naval prowess has raised questions regarding the maintenance and reliability of its military technology.
